Received: by 2002:a05:7412:8521:b0:e2:908c:2ebd with SMTP id t33csp556095rdf; Fri, 3 Nov 2023 08:18:36 -0700 (PDT) X-Google-Smtp-Source: AGHT+IGYVUGA8z15/zn3Vd4xJc7OqM8p2jw6gKWFsxQws5Q5RxTA6oBcsJUZsy9MLPjrHSCWGWTY X-Received: by 2002:a92:d38c:0:b0:359:438a:411b with SMTP id o12-20020a92d38c000000b00359438a411bmr7335086ilo.3.1699024716615; Fri, 03 Nov 2023 08:18:36 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1699024716; cv=none; d=google.com; s=arc-20160816; b=OtQTnPZmfA9m8EvVAFcEQole3NECwhcOP6bhXmuRNSyLDAh/5wb8lBiQs1BlWTDhHU HDRlr3QHGB+9vlLPXhC0D76fB9pcQSVW6/oWZTY0yETwwSMKq3SigNqUnpl7Tdzjl+Hf ovLUwpTXcY6khxy7zbDg3yquv+EwaI/M4mtD1P4tWIpCYQZpxbcqEjf1eX62iqKT/r6e mfLiwR4HaHvamOms1ZVcrc+3DcZvJdym8ytM+BHxJPNJ+BcXzBvTnjAi4fAg2I27clpN yuwhNzwu0J9VlKJ9a5/pdimR2YYdir0FJuC+X27NUq5yrlxOT5RNA0p1gQ2ewH8x+UkF V0JQ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:user-agent:in-reply-to:content-disposition :mime-version:references:message-id:subject:cc:to:from:date; bh=kf+vV6dGaXMCrZKWJfkLi3MC8COssA0h4OKIFYwaxYE=; fh=Y4UpxTBZPexLY9rw7rzgHFGp+RdoRwqjvFGHSnAWVR0=; b=lUrWbMDXahfmRT2CveEjXKp/vZIy1+AsqePWHZYiooVFS+/8YPwQllDUuK5J0B5jgB 73h7h6lcF/7FMp9UlcV4T0p5jRtQomLmcCAGdf8i70VhxjEXTuNJ1eVjYREV+xzUQqKj 2XiqeQUy9VAb8Ao6/vmefWO5dU5rUJugAfjpEPLAzpGPD2qW7PYLnmWIelVtBnxcVEwj /198HEgMJg/oFRvBxMtwlOoah3RoImcf3Ni1MbtZnNkQYcIslrrWVjKyrP93dGtY9V6D 8MsclV/fEoy7GneVaErzDGlyYEkfGf8YH/gCrVP7AhCqe9fftuODfpMEQ31tsaIlTWLj jvuw==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::3:7 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from snail.vger.email (snail.vger.email. [2620:137:e000::3:7]) by mx.google.com with ESMTPS id a23-20020aa78657000000b0068a590d803csi1625319pfo.361.2023.11.03.08.18.36 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 03 Nov 2023 08:18:36 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::3:7 as permitted sender) client-ip=2620:137:e000::3:7; Authentication-Results: m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::3:7 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: from out1.vger.email (depot.vger.email [IPv6:2620:137:e000::3:0]) by snail.vger.email (Postfix) with ESMTP id 76F6B838B3EE; Fri, 3 Nov 2023 08:18:35 -0700 (PDT) X-Virus-Status: Clean X-Virus-Scanned: clamav-milter 0.103.10 at snail.vger.email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S233685AbjKCPSd (ORCPT + 99 others); Fri, 3 Nov 2023 11:18:33 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:50406 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S233463AbjKCPSb (ORCPT ); Fri, 3 Nov 2023 11:18:31 -0400 Received: from hi1smtp01.de.adit-jv.com (smtp1.de.adit-jv.com [93.241.18.167]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id DDB171B2; Fri, 3 Nov 2023 08:18:28 -0700 (PDT) Received: from hi2exch02.adit-jv.com (hi2exch02.adit-jv.com [10.72.92.28]) by hi1smtp01.de.adit-jv.com (Postfix) with ESMTP id 9CECC5201D3; Fri, 3 Nov 2023 16:18:27 +0100 (CET) Received: from vmlxhi-118.adit-jv.com (10.72.93.77) by hi2exch02.adit-jv.com (10.72.92.28)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.1.2507.34; Fri, 3 Nov 2023 16:18:27 +0100 Date: Fri, 3 Nov 2023 16:18:22 +0100 From: Hardik Gajjar To: Mathias Nyman CC: Hardik Gajjar , , , , , , , Subject: Re: [PATCH v7 1/2] usb: xhci: Add timeout argument in address_device USB HCD callback Message-ID: <20231103151822.GA101660@vmlxhi-118.adit-jv.com> References: <20231027152029.104363-1-hgajjar@de.adit-jv.com> M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Disposition: inline In-Reply-To: User-Agent: Mutt/1.9.4 (2018-02-28) X-Originating-IP: [10.72.93.77] X-ClientProxiedBy: hi2exch02.adit-jv.com (10.72.92.28) To hi2exch02.adit-jv.com (10.72.92.28) X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00, RCVD_IN_DNSWL_BLOCKED,SPF_HELO_NONE,SPF_PASS,T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org X-Greylist: Sender passed SPF test, not delayed by milter-greylist-4.6.4 (snail.vger.email [0.0.0.0]); Fri, 03 Nov 2023 08:18:35 -0700 (PDT) On Mon, Oct 30, 2023 at 12:45:54PM +0200, Mathias Nyman wrote: > On 27.10.2023 18.20, Hardik Gajjar wrote: > > - The HCD address_device callback now accepts a user-defined timeout value > > in milliseconds, providing better control over command execution times. > > - The default timeout value for the address_device command has been set > > to 5000 ms, aligning with the USB 3.2 specification. However, this > > timeout can be adjusted as needed. > > - The xhci_setup_device function has been updated to accept the timeout > > value, allowing it to specify the maximum wait time for the command > > operation to complete. > > - The hub driver has also been updated to accommodate the newly added > > timeout parameter during the SET_ADDRESS request. > > > > Signed-off-by: Hardik Gajjar > > For the xhci parts > > Reviewed-by: Mathias Nyman > > @Greg KH, Friendly reminder. Thanks, Hardik